Biological function summary
5-HT-2B plays a role in modulating the contractility and remodeling of cardiac tissue influencing vascular function and smooth muscle behavior impacting gastrointestinal motility and contributing to liver regeneration. It is not part of a large multiprotein complex but interacts with other cellular components to exert its biological functions. The receptor's activation leads to various intracellular responses influencing different physiological effects depending on the tissue context.
Pathways
Serotonin receptor 2B is involved in the serotonin signaling pathway and the calcium signaling pathway. These pathways impact several physiological processes including mood regulation and cardiovascular function. The receptor interacts with proteins such as phospholipase C which mediates the hydrolysis of phospholipids in the membrane releasing inositol trisphosphate and causing a rise in intracellular calcium levels important for function continuation.
